Newspaper Unknown
June 1909

Grandfather Houlette, one of the pioneers of Madison county passed away at the home of his son, W. P. Houlette, near Hanley on Sunday, June 27th in his 93rd year. Mr. Houlette was an old and respected citizen having come from Illinois in 1867. The aged wife and five sons and two daughters survive him. The funeral service was held at Hanly, Tuesday afternoon and he was laid to rest in the St. Charles cemetery. Mr. Houlette has been a faithful member of the M. Winterset Reporter – July 1, 1909
Pg 3

Obituary

James Dale Houlette was born in Murser County, Pennsylvania, on the 4th day of September 1816, and departed this life on the 27th day of June 1909, age 92 years, 9 months and 23 days. He was united in marriage to Agnes S. Clark on the 29th day of January 1844, to this union were born seven children Margret Slinker, of Payett, Idaho; Robert S. Houlette, of Friona, Texas, C. Houlette, of Truro, Iowa; L. S. Houlette, of Kansas City, Mo.; W. P. Houlette, of St. Charles, Ia.; Stephen Houlette, of Des Moines, Ia., and Susen E. Schwek, of Des Moines, Ia. He leaves a wife and the above named children who are all living, to mourn his loss. In the year 1845 he moved from the state of Pennsylvania to Ohio, then in the year 1847 he with his wife moved to Marnard County, Illinois, there they lived and reared their family and in September 1867 he moved to Madison County, Iowa, and has lived in this county until his death. He united with the Methodist church in 1850 and lived a consistent member until death. He was a kind father and husband, and was loved by all. The funeral was held Tuesday at the Hanley church conducted by Rev. Williams. Interment was made in the St. Charles cemetery.
